Chapter 1327 Promotion of Practice
Chapter 1327 Promotion of Practice
The process of teaching students is not too difficult for Lin Si.
And among the two thousand students, there are indeed quite a few who have outstanding talents and aptitudes, but were previously undiscovered cultivation geniuses due to various reasons.
Many cultivation geniuses on this continent were eventually taken away by the sect, such as Yin Li back then.
The sect has branches in many countries in the mainland, in order to find young geniuses with good qualifications, and eventually enter the sect.However, the disciples recruited in this way are often only a minority.
The sect's main source of recruiting disciples is mostly to use a similar assessment method every three to five years to recruit talented disciples from all over the continent.
Generally, when the sect recruits disciples, the scene is extremely grand, and there will often be scenes of tens of thousands of people gathered outside the mountain gate.
These people often come from the surrounding countries of the sect, whether they are nobles, wealthy gentry or ordinary people, they only want their children and descendants to pass the examination and join the sect.
However, those who can successfully join in the end can only be regarded as a minority.
When it comes to overall strength, the three factions of Tianwaitian cannot compare with the two great empires.If sects such as the Xingluomen of the Wuji Palace confronted each other head-on, they would not be opponents of Gaozhen Chilou and other countries at all.
But if we only talk about high-end combat power, the sect stands at the pinnacle of this continent.
Just looking at the fact that there are no masters in the holy realm in the two great empires, we can see that the most attractive place for practitioners is actually the sect.
The sect has long-inherited practice books and many secret methods passed down from generation to generation. Moreover, the sect exists specifically for practice. It is destined to be more efficient than the academy in cultivating practitioners.
However, this does not mean that with the existence of sects and academies, no genius will be buried.
Just looking at Yin Li, one can tell that if Suqiu hadn't happened to pass by that Tianhe small mountain village back then, and then happened to notice her, then she would not be a disciple of Xingong now, let alone become a master of the late stage of Tianhe today. .
Perhaps, she still doesn't know how to practice cultivation today.
If it wasn't for Can Nie who happened to buy Ruoruo, maybe when she grew up, she would just be a servant of a certain wealthy family, and she might even die because of a tragic situation.
Who can be sure that the Cangluo Continent does not have other people who are extremely talented, but until the day they die of old age, they have not even set foot on the road of cultivation, but have been working with hoes and shovels all the time?
Many mountain villages are very closed, and there may not have been a practitioner in the past hundred years, and no one knows how to practice.At that time, how would the people around know whether there was a peerless genius who could have been famous all over the continent?
Not every place can get news about sect recruitment, at least there are no sects in the six southeastern countries.
Not everyone can afford to sit in the teleportation array, maybe by the time they rush out of the mountain gate after several months or even a year or two, the assessment has long been over.
Likewise, not everyone has the opportunity to go to school.
And even if they embarked on the road of cultivation, due to reasons such as family circumstances and lack of teaching, some people may have to stop continuing to practice just after they have just reached the initial stage of observation.
Some of them, if they can enter the sect, may become masters in the extreme realm and even the sky realm in the future.
In addition, no matter the sect or the academy, there is a huge flaw.
Because the students are young, when they are assessed, what they look at is their own aptitude.
Some people have reached the Transitional Realm at the age of ten, some have reached the Observation Realm at the age of ten, and some are still at the Beginning Realm at the age of ten.Of course, the sect will choose those who have changed the state, and the academy will of course choose those who are above the peeping state. As for those who are in the initial state, they will be judged as mediocre, and no one will care about them anymore.
The reason is simple, his talent is not good, otherwise why is his cultivation so slow?
Of course it's not worth wasting resources and energy on such a disciple.
However, Lin Si knew very well that this talent only represented aptitude, but not comprehension.
After changing realms, no matter which realm you are in, you actually need a certain amount of comprehension.And after breaking the realm, savvy becomes more important than root bones.
Many sect disciples reached the breaking state in their twenties, but they were still in the breaking state throughout their lives.
The sword master didn't enter the breaking realm until he was 33 years old, but he is now the number one master in the Xuanluo Continent.
Among the 2000 people, there are similar young monks.Maybe they will still be at a low level in the future, but it is also possible that among them there will be someone who is at the Breaking Realm or even higher.
After teaching more than two thousand people, Lin Si finally discovered that in fact, Yueguo and Qingchuan Qiansong Qianlan and other countries are not really unable to become masters of the heavenly realm, but that they did not have such conditions in the past.
In the past, this place was regarded as a backward place by the outside world, and the parties of various sects also lacked interest here, and the college level here was not high enough, and the buried geniuses were actually much more than those big countries in the central part of the mainland.
After all, root talent is innate.Could it be that people born in the six southeastern countries are inherently inferior to the outside world?
As for comprehension, are people from the six southeastern countries more stupid than people outside?
This is obviously impossible.
When Lin Si thought of this, he even had an idea. After the war was completely over and the Xuanluo Continent was defeated, he and Tang Xiaozhi would simply return to the Academy City and live a life of teaching students.
In that way, after a few decades, there may be more heavenly masters belonging to their own country in the Moon Kingdom.
At the same time, he also suggested to Yue Luoning that try to set up a practice testing institution in most cities of Yue Kingdom, and promote it to all surrounding villages and towns.Regardless of whether it is a newborn baby or an adult, everyone has a free opportunity to test whether they have the aptitude for spiritual cultivation.
Whether to choose this path in the end depends on the individual.But if the qualifications are extremely outstanding, the imperial court officials will consider helping to train them, and even directly recommend them to Lin Si.
There are many detailed rules, such as the grading of root qualifications, such as the assessment of understanding, of course, it is up to Yue Luoning to discuss with the ministers of the court.
Yue Luoning also readily accepted this suggestion.
She knew it would be a big deal and a long one.After all, for this initiative, there will be a lot of people dispatched, and they all need salaries.
Not to mention the magic circle to test the aptitude of the root bones, it may take a long time for the magicians to be busy.As for the spirit stones consumed by the magic circle, we can only count on Lin Si to create more Yinli magic cores.
In the short term, there may be no return at all.
Yue Luoning has a long-term vision, and she knows that if this measure can be continued, the number of mid-level and high-level monks in Yue Kingdom will probably be many times more than it is now.
Maybe it's a coincidence, maybe it's fate, Lian Qin and Lin Si seem to have taken two completely opposite paths at this time.
Lian Qin wanted to kill all practitioners, while Lin Si was looking for practitioners.Lian Qin wants to exterminate the method of practice, while Lin Si is doing his best to promote the method of practice.
Apart from the former hatred, this pair of master and apprentice finally began to have an ideological confrontation.
It's just that Lin Si at this moment didn't realize this at all.
Maybe even if he realized it, he wouldn't care at all, after all, he never thought about the day when he and Lian Qin would turn enemies into friends.
At this time, he is not only teaching others to practice, but also thinking about his future path of practice.
As for the practice of Tianyin cultivators, he is at the forefront.In front of him, there is no experience left by his predecessors at all.
And his biggest problem now is naturally that he has no enchantment.
For this reason, he even took the time to meet the master of Jianzong again.This senior is a master of the holy realm, maybe he can give himself some pointers and suggestions in this regard?
Naturally, the Master of Sword Sect would not refuse his request for advice.Even if he retreated [-] steps, Lin Si was still a disciple of Jianzong.
As for the problem of Lin Si not having a barrier, the Lord of the Sword Sect has naturally noticed it long ago.
It's just that he used to think that this might be a special feature of Tianyin practitioners. Although Lin Si no longer has Tianyin, his path of cultivation is still different from normal practitioners.
It doesn't seem strange to have any abnormalities on him, right?
He didn't expect that Lin Si was actually distressed by this.
"The enchantment is indeed the foundation of entering the holy realm. The sanctuary of the holy realm actually evolved from the enchantment. The enchantment can be said to be the embryonic form of the sanctuary."
After listening to Lin Si's description, his first sentence made Lin Si smile wryly.
"Then do I have no hope of advancing to the Holy Realm?"
Although his current achievements are already astonishing enough, if he fails to advance to the Holy Realm, he will still be hit hard.For him, the greatest joy of practice is to be able to continuously improve and enter new levels.
This kind of fun is the biggest driving force for him to move forward, and it has already surpassed all kinds of external effects brought about by the improvement of strength, such as destructive power, such as fame and fortune.
If the road ahead came to an abrupt end, it would certainly be difficult for him to accept.
What's more, if he didn't have the strength of the Holy Realm, he might not be able to deal with the invasion crisis of the Xuanluo Continent in the future.
The master of Jianzong smiled and shook his head: "This is not the case."
"Is there any other way to own the sanctuary?" Lin Si's eyes suddenly brightened.
"Why do you have to be obsessed with the sanctuary?" The master of the sword sect shook his head with a little disappointment: "Could it be that you still don't understand it until today?"
After Lin Si pondered for a while, he realized something: "You mean, you can become a holy place if you have a sanctuary, and you can become a sanctuary without a sanctuary?"
The Lord of Sword Sect nodded slightly and said: "That's right, before that, I also thought that only by possessing an enchantment can one achieve a heavenly realm. But now that you don't have an enchantment, you have instead become the strongest heavenly realm. Your perception of artistic conception, and It is not inferior to other heavenly realm monks. Who dares to assert that you will definitely need the sanctuary to advance to the holy realm in the future?"
Only then did Lin Si suddenly realize that he had indeed been obsessed with enchantment and sanctuary before.
After all, a cultivator is a heavenly cultivator who owns an enchantment, and a strong man is a saint who owns a sanctuary. This has long been regarded as the consensus of the practice community.So much so that now, without a barrier, he sometimes doubts whether he has really entered the heavenly realm.
However, the Lord of Sword Sect is right, his perception is not inferior to other heavenly realms, and his strength is even stronger than them.
If I am not a monk in the heaven realm now, what is it?
What's more, even if it really isn't, so what?Even if he is really not a heavenly realm now, what's the harm in changing to a realm with another name?
(End of this chapter)
